AFR-200/250 PTFE Film Wrapped High Temperature Resistant Wire 600V – BYC Cables

Product Overview

Feature Specification
Product Models AFR-200 (Bare Copper), AFR-250 (Silver-plated Copper)
Construction Type PTFE (Polytetrafluoroethylene) Tape Wrapping & Sintering
Rated Voltage 600V AC (Enhanced High Voltage Grade)
Temperature Range -60°C to +200°C (-76°F to +392°F) [Bare Copper]
-60°C to +250°C (-76°F to +482°F) [Silver-plated Copper]
Conductor Material High-purity Bare Copper or Silver-plated Copper
Available Colors Black, White, Blue, Yellow, Green, Red, Brown
Applications Critical internal wiring for aerospace, aviation, weaponry, and naval systems requiring a 600V rating in extreme thermal environments.

Technical Parameter Table

Data represents standard unshielded 600V configurations with 0.25mm insulation thickness.

Cross-section (mm2) Conductor Construction (No./mm) Conductor Diameter (mm) Insulation Thickness (mm) Finished Outside Diameter (mm) Max Resistance @ 20°C (68°F) (Ohm/km) [Bare Copper / Silver-plated]
0.35 75 / 0.08 or 19 / 0.16 0.80 / 0.76 0.25 1.36 / 1.32 (+/- 0.12) 52.4 / 48.5
0.50 105 / 0.08 or 19 / 0.20 1.01 / 0.96 0.25 1.57 / 1.52 (+/- 0.12) 37.4 / 34.7
0.75 147 / 0.08 or 19 / 0.23 1.18 / 1.09 0.25 1.74 / 1.65 (+/- 0.12) 26.8 / 24.8
1.00 203 / 0.08 or 19 / 0.26 1.38 / 1.23 0.25 1.94 / 1.79 (+/- 0.20) 19.3 / 17.9
1.20 238 / 0.08 or 19 / 0.28 1.50 / 1.35 0.25 2.06 / 1.91 (+/- 0.20) 16.5 / 15.3

Professional Performance Features

  • Advanced Tape Wrapping Technology: Unlike common extruded wires, our PTFE tape wrapped and sintered insulation provides a more compact, uniform dielectric layer with superior resistance to mechanical stress and cut-through.
  • Silver-plated Copper Advantage: The silver-plated conductor option ensures maximum conductivity and eliminates oxidation at sustained temperatures up to +250°C (482°F), essential for high-reliability aerospace avionics.
  • 600V Safety Margin: Engineered with an increased insulation wall (0.25mm) compared to standard 250V wires, providing a robust safety factor for higher-power internal equipment connections.
  • Chemical & Environmental Inertness: Fully resistant to all common aviation hydraulic fluids, fuels, lubricants, and corrosive cleaning agents. The PTFE material is inherently non-aging and UV stable.
  • Flexibility & Weight Saving: The stranded conductor structure allows for a very tight bend radius, making it ideal for high-density wiring harnesses in cramped electronic enclosures without adding significant weight.

Material Guide for Customers

  • Bare Copper: The standard choice for general-purpose high-temperature applications up to +200°C (392°F).
  • Silver-plated Copper: Recommended for extreme environments up to +250°C (482°F) or where high-frequency signal integrity is a priority.
  • PTFE Wrapping: A specialized manufacturing process that results in a denser and more flexible insulation compared to standard plastic extrusion.
